PSG

PSG

In the first matchup between these two PSG did exactly what everyone thought they’d do. They got into space and Mbappe and company made Milan pay. No reason to think they’re going to approach this any different.

PLAYERS TO WATCH

ATTACK

You cannot stop him, you can only hope to contain him. I wrote this last time in reference to Kylian Mbappe and it proved to be true. I think it’s true again today. I expect PSG to score today and so Milan will need to too.

Much like Milan and Leão (or any other team and their star), everything goes through Mbappe. PSG rely on him to score, of course, but they also rely on him to stretch the defense, draw defenders, and open up lanes for teammates. All of this happened with Mbappe opening the the scoring, then Randal Kolo Muani and Kang-In Lee scoring through wide open lanes. If Milan play aggressive and with a high line again, expect the same outcome.

DEFENSE

PSG likes to win the ball back with their midfield and get into transition quickly. This is how Achraf Hakimi scores and assists as much as he does despite being a LB. What their defense doesn’t do well is track back and defend due to a lack of pace at CB. Another component to why PSG like to win the ball with their midfield and get going is because of Donnarumma at the back and his poor distribution skills. Milan need to take advantage of these things and get PSG chasing and press the hell out of Donnarumma when the ball is at his feet.

MILAN

MILAN

If Milan is to win today they cannot get into a back-and-forth game with PSG. Milan…and Pioli, need to change their approach to this game because doing the same as last time won’t work. As mentioned above, I fully expect PSG to score so Milan is going to need multiple goals today. With the midfield continuing their subpar play, leaning on Leão, Theo, and Pulisic to lead a counter-attacking approach will be key in my opinion.

PLAYERS TO WATCH

ATTACK

If Pioli plays an aggressive high line again today then I don’t see how Milan produces anything, at least with the midfield playing the way they are. If the midfield has their game of the year then maybe, but more than likely Milan will need to sit back more and try to counter PSG. Most importantly this can get Leão into space as well as utilize Pulisic’s ball-carrying and distribution skills. Having RLC back will help as well as he’s been one of the few midfielders willing to make runs into the box and is pretty good at ball-carrying too. This is a good composition of players to lead a counter-attacking approach, I hope we see it.

DEFENSE

The backline is pretty strong having the opening round starters available. Thiaw showed signs of improvement last game and Calabria has been solid as well. Still, Calabria vs Mbappe is the most concerning and a more defensive posture will help with this as well as helping to open up Milan’s counter-attacking game.

Milan’s midfielders were poor at tracking back and finding the right player to mark in their first meeting vs PSG but again, easier to mark if you’re sitting back some and are organized. Krunic left last game banged up so we might see Musah at DM but overall the midfield will need to stay tight on PSG’s midfielders making runs into the box looking for that cutback pass from Mbappe. Tomori and Maignan are good and in good form but they can’t stop everything from reaching the back of the net so a complete effort will be needed.
